Seedance 2.0 vs Sora 2: Side-by-Side Comparison
Before the deep dives, here's the full spec sheet — use it to shortlist, then read the sections below for the reasoning behind each call.
| Dimension | Seedance 2.0 (ByteDance) | Sora 2 (OpenAI) |
|---|---|---|
| Motion realism & physics | Dedicated physics engine; strong object persistence and gravity-aware motion (tested) | Excellent physical plausibility in complex scenes (vendor-reported, widely echoed by community) |
| Scene complexity & multi-shot | Multi-shot generation supported; handles multi-subject scenes well (tested) | Known for complex scenes, multi-shot storytelling, and cinematic composition (vendor-reported) |
| Native audio | Yes — native audio generation built in (tested) | Reported to generate audio; specifics vary by access tier (community-reported) |
| Resolution | Up to 2K output | Up to 4K reported (vendor-reported; not independently verified) |
| Aspect ratios | Multiple standard ratios supported | Multiple standard ratios supported |
| Prompt control | Text prompts, reference images, camera control options | Strong text understanding; reference and camera controls reported |
| Access | Web app, API, plus Fal.ai / Dreamina / Hugging Face | ChatGPT subscription tiers and API |
| Pricing model | Published credit costs per generation (transparent) | Subscription tiers + credits/API usage (qualitative; specifics approximate) |
| Free trial | 5 free generations, no card required | Trial/subscription required (varies by region and tier) |
| Commercial rights | Explicit commercial license on Pro plan | Terms as reported; review current OpenAI terms |
| Best for | Client work, high-volume content, budget-conscious creators | Film-style experimentation, cinematic storytelling, OpenAI ecosystem users |

Pricing Transparency
Winner: Seedance 2.0 (tested)
Seedance 2 Pro publishes exact credit costs per generation, which makes budgeting trivial:
| Plan | Price | Credits | Notes |
|---|---|---|---|
| Basic | $9.9/mo | 260 credits | Entry tier |
| Pro | $19.99/mo | 530 credits | Commercial license, 16-bit HDR & EXR export |
| Max | $29.9/mo | 790 credits | Fastest generation, permanent storage |
| Generation | Credits |
|---|---|
| 5s / 720p (Fast) | 73 |
| 5s / 720p | 90 |
| 5s / 1080p | 224 |
| 15s / 1080p | 673 |
You can calculate exactly how many videos a plan produces before you pay. A Basic plan, for example, covers roughly three 5s/1080p generations or about 2.8 15s/1080p generations per month — you know the math before you commit.
The credit math, worked out: 260 credits ÷ 224 credits per 5s/1080p clip = 1.16 clips per month on Basic — enough for a single polished ad spot, not a content calendar. That's the trap: the entry tier's credit count looks generous until you divide it by a 1080p generation. If your pipeline needs daily output, the number that matters is 790 ÷ 673 = 1.17 clips per day on Max, not the monthly price tag. Do this division before you buy, not after.
Sora 2's pricing is subscription-based (ChatGPT tiers) plus credits/API usage, and OpenAI has not published stable per-generation costs. Any specific per-video price you see for Sora 2 is approximate and changes with tier, resolution, and demand. That makes cost forecasting genuinely hard for production work.
Rule of Thumb: If you need to quote a per-video cost to a client, use the model whose per-generation price is published. That's Seedance 2.0 today.
